Many tasks for autonomous agents or robots are best described by a specification of the environment and a specification of the available actions the agent or robot can perform. Combining such a specification with the possibility to imperatively program a robot or agent is what we call action-based imperative programming. One of the most successful such approaches is Golog (1). YAGI is Yet Another Golog Interpreter that is based on and inspired by Golog, but adopts a more practical approach, aiming at a small, portable stand-alone interpreter, that can be easily embedded in regular software programming environments. YAGI combines the benefits of a principled domain specification with a clean, small and simple programming language with formal syntax and semantics.
